there is no ANT_18_BRANCH at the moment.

I remember there was a time during ant 1.6 development where there was both a lot of development going on on the ANT_16_BRANCH and also on trunk, and a lot of changes have been merged.

Working in trunk only at least for the first half of the life of a major release is easier and keeps us focused on fixing bugs or low risk additions. Of course if some committers feel that we should start immediately preparing a 1.9.x version with very different objectives from 1.8.x development we can branch.
